Helpful Cycling Tips for Senior Adventurers
One balmy afternoon, Harold gathered the group under the shade of an old oak tree, sharing five essential cycling health tips for seniors:
1. Start Slow and Gentle: Much like the first steps of a child, begin your cycling journey with short, easy rides to build strength, avoiding strain and fatigue.
2. Choose the Right Gear: Comfort is king. Investing in a well-fitted bicycle and safety gear ensures both safety and an enjoyable ride every time.
3. Hydration is Key: Carry a water bottle, and sip often. True adventures flourish best when the body is well-hydrated.
4. Stretch and Warm Up: Before setting off, a few stretches can do wonders, preventing discomfort and enhancing the ride’s pleasure.
5. Listen to Your Body: The truly wise adventurer attends to their body’s signals, resting when needed, ensuring that cycling remains joyful and sustainable.
